<p>Ingredients<br />
<a href="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/07/005.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-medium wp-image-248" title="005" src="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/07/005.jpg?w=300&#038;h=225" alt="" width="300" height="225" /></a></p>
<p>1 1/2 cups water</p>
<p>1/2 cup dried lentils</p>
<p>Cooking spray</p>
<p>1 cup chopped onion</p>
<p>1/4 cup grated carrot</p>
<p>2 teaspoons minced garlic</p>
<p>2 tablespoons tomato paste</p>
<p>3/4 teaspoon dried oregano</p>
<p>1/2 teaspoon chili powder</p>
<p>3/4 teaspoon salt, divided</p>
<p>3/4 cup cooked pearl barley</p>
<p>1/2 cup panko (Japanese breadcrumbs)</p>
<p>1/2 teaspoon black pepper</p>
<p>2 large egg whites</p>
<p>1 large egg</p>
<p>3 tablespoons canola oil, divided</p>
<p>7 Grain Deli Flat burger buns</p>
<p>Directions:</p>
<p>1. If you haven’t already done so, cook barley. I cooked 1 cup of barley in 2.5 cups of water, for 30 minutes. This means I have leftover barley…yay!<br />
<a href="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/07/002.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-medium wp-image-249" title="002" src="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/07/002.jpg?w=300&#038;h=225" alt="" width="300" height="225" /></a></p>
<p>2. Combine 1 1/2 cups water and lentils in a saucepan; bring to a boil. Cover, reduce heat, and simmer 25 minutes or until lentils are tender. Drain. Place half of lentils in a large bowl. Place remaining lentils in a food processor; process until smooth. Add processed lentils to whole lentils in bowl.<br />
<a href="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/07/0042.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-medium wp-image-252" title="004" src="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/07/0042.jpg?w=225&#038;h=300" alt="" width="225" height="300" /></a></p>
<p>3. Heat a large nonstick skillet over medium-high heat. Coat pan with cooking spray. Add onion and carrot; sauté 6 minutes or until tender, stirring occasionally. Add garlic; cook 1 minute, stirring constantly. Add tomato paste, oregano, chili powder, and 1/4 teaspoon salt; cook 1 minute, stirring constantly. Add onion mixture to lentils. Add remaining 1/2 teaspoon salt, barley, and next 4 ingredients (through egg); stir well. Cover and refrigerate 30 minutes-1 hour or until firm.<br />
<a href="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/07/008.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-medium wp-image-253" title="008" src="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/07/008.jpg?w=300&#038;h=225" alt="" width="300" height="225" /></a><br />
<a href="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/07/009.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-medium wp-image-254" title="009" src="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/07/009.jpg?w=300&#038;h=225" alt="" width="300" height="225" /></a></p>
<p>4. Divide mixture into 8 portions, shaping each into a 1/2-inch-thick patty. Heat 1 1/2 tablespoons oil in a large nonstick skillet over medium-high heat. Add 4 patties; cook 3 minutes on each side or until browned. Repeat procedure with remaining 1 1/2 tablespoons oil and 4 patties.</p>

<div><span style="font-size:x-small;"><span style="text-decoration:underline;"><span style="font-size:x-small;">Shiitake and Sweet Pea Risotto<br />
</span></span></span><a href="http://www.cookinglight.com" target="_blank">Inspired by March 2010’s Cooking Light</a><br />
Ingredients:<br />
4 Cups fat-free, less-sodium chicken broth<br />
1 T butter<br />
½ cup chopped onion<br />
1.5 tsp minced garlic, divided<br />
1 cup uncooked Arborio rice<br />
½ cup dry white wine<br />
4 cups thinly sliced shiitake mushroom caps<br />
¾ cup frozen green peas<br />
6 T parmesan cheese, divided<br />
¼ tsp ground black pepper</div>
<p><a href="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/03/0101.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-medium wp-image-183" title="010" src="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/03/0101.jpg?w=300&#038;h=225" alt="" width="300" height="225" /></a></span></div>
<div>
<span style="font-size:x-small;">Directions:</p>
<p>1) Bring chicken broth to a simmer in a saucepan, keep warm over low heat.</p>
<p>2) Melt butter in a large skillet over medium heat. Add onion; cook 2 minutes. Add 1 tsp garlic; cook 30 seconds, stirring constantly. Add rice; cook 1 minute, stirring constantly. Add wine; cook 2 minutes or until liquid is absorbed, stirring frequently. Stir in ½ cup broth; cook 2 minutes or until liquid is absorbed, stirring constantly. Add remaining broth, ½ cup at a time, stirring constantly until each portion of broth is absorbed before adding the next (about 20 minutes).<br />
<a href="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/03/0142.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-medium wp-image-190" title="014" src="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/03/0142.jpg?w=300&#038;h=225" alt="" width="300" height="225" /></a></p>
<p>3) Spray large skillet over medium heat. Add sliced mushrooms, and sauté until tender. Add remaining garlic, and set aside.<br />
<a href="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/03/0171.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-medium wp-image-192" title="017" src="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/03/0171.jpg?w=300&#038;h=225" alt="" width="300" height="225" /></a></p>
<p>4) Stir mushrooms, peas, ¼ cup cheese, and pepper into risotto; cook 3 minutes. Serve, and sprinkle each serving with cheese.<br />
<a href="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/03/0181.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-medium wp-image-193" title="018" src="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/03/0181.jpg?w=300&#038;h=225" alt="" width="300" height="225" /></a></p>

<div><span style="font-size:x-small;"><span style="font-size:x-small;">Coconut Shrimp<br />
Inspired by <a href="http://find.myrecipes.com/recipes/recipefinder.dyn?action=displayRecipe&amp;recipe_id=1949689" target="_blank">Cooking Light&#8217;s Coconut Shrimp</a><br />
Ingredients:<br />
30 medium frozen shrimp<br />
½ cup flaked sweetened coconut<br />
½ cup whole wheat panko crumbs<br />
1/3 cup cornstarch<br />
¾ cup liquid egg whites<br />
*1-2 tsp. canola oil if desired<br />
<a href="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/03/029.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-medium wp-image-171" title="029" src="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/03/029.jpg?w=300&#038;h=225" alt="" width="300" height="225" /></a></span></span><span style="font-size:x-small;"><span style="font-size:x-small;"><span style="font-size:x-small;">Directions:<br />
1) Preheat oven to 350*|<br />
<span style="font-size:x-small;">2)Thaw shrimp under running water. Peel, leaving tails intact; discard shells. Place coconut in a food processor; pulse 6 times or until finely chopped.</span><br />
</span></span></span>3) Add panko; pulse to combine.<br />
<a href="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/03/030.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-medium wp-image-170" title="030" src="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/03/030.jpg?w=300&#038;h=225" alt="" width="300" height="225" /></a></div>
<p>4) Place coconut mixture in a shallow dish. Place cornstarch in a shallow dish. Place egg whites in a shallow dish.</p>
<p>5) Working with 1 shrimp at a time, dredge shrimp in cornstarch, shaking off excess. Dip in egg whites; dredge in coconut mixture.<br />
<a href="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/03/031.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-medium wp-image-172" title="031" src="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/03/031.jpg?w=300&#038;h=225" alt="" width="300" height="225" /></a><br />
6) Heat a large nonstick skillet over medium-high heat. Spray with cooking spray. (Add 1-2 teaspoons of canola oil to pan if needed); swirl to coat. Add 10-12 shrimp to pan; coat tops of shrimp with cooking spray. Cook shrimp 2 1/2 minutes on each side or until done. Repeat procedure 3 times with remaining oil and shrimp.<br />
<a href="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/03/033.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-medium wp-image-173" title="033" src="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/03/033.jpg?w=300&#038;h=225" alt="" width="300" height="225" /></a></p>
<p>7) Place shrimp in oven on a lined cookie sheet for 3-5 minutes for an extra crispy coating!</p>

<div><span style="font-size:x-small;">Mom’s Marinated Vegetables<br />
</span><span style="font-size:x-small;">3 stalks celery<br />
</span><span style="font-size:x-small;">4 stalks broccoli<br />
8 large mushrooms (halved)<br />
½ head cauliflower<br />
½ red pepper cut in strips<br />
½ yellow pepper cut in strips<br />
½ orange pepper cut in strips<br />
<a href="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/03/008.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-medium wp-image-161" title="008" src="http://atwinstake.files.wordpress.com/2010/03/008.jpg?w=300&#038;h=225" alt="" width="300" height="225" /></a></span></div>
<p>Sauce:<br />
½ cup sugar (or 1 tsp. artificial sweetener)*<br />
1 tsp. Dry mustard<br />
¼ cup vinegar<br />
¼ cup polyunsaturated oil<br />
¼ cup water<br />
½ small onion-grated<br />
1 T poppy seed<br />
*It&#8217;s up to you whether you want to use the real sugar, or artificial.  I&#8217;ve tried it with both, and they taste relatively similar (and sweet!)</p>
<p>Directions: Whisk ingredients together or blend in a blender and pour over the veggies. Mix thoroughly, cover, and marinate all day, stirring occasionally.<br />
